Cryptocurrency class action lawsuits: a new frontierICOs raised approximately $4 billion in 2017 alone, outpacing all venture capital raised in the United States. Because anyone with an idea for a project can gain financial backing without going through the formalities of an IPO, however, there are obvious chances for the public to be scammed, and we likely have only begun to see the beginning of class action lawsuits filed relating to blockchain-related companies or companies that participated in ICOs. Any company planning to conduct a token offering using an ICO should proceed with caution, and anyone looking to invest in a token offering should make sure it is conducted in compliance with applicable state and federal laws.
